STRUCTURE
motifs/domains
  • six transmembrane segments
  • a pore domain between TM5 and TM6
  • a cytoplasmic N terminal tail
  • a C terminal comprising a cNMP binding site and a leucine zipper homology domain (CLZ)

  • basic FUNCTION
  • ligand gated ion (Na+/Ki/Ca2+)channel of rod receptors
  • having a pivotal role in the degenerative process
  • CNGA1 is indispensable for channel activation

    signaling sensory transduction/olfaction , sensory transduction/vision
  • visual signal transduction is mediated by a G-protein coupled cascade using cGMP as second messenger
  • a component
  • forming an heterotetramer with CNGB1 formed by three A and one B subunits
  • forming heterooligomeric complex with CNG4

  • GRB14 interacts with the rod photoreceptor-specific cyclic-nucleotide-gated channel alpha subunit (CNGA1) and decreases its affinity for cyclic guanosine monophosphate
  • F-actin is essential for the trafficking of CNGA1 to the ciliary plasma membrane (PM) , and coordinates the formations of disk membrane rim region and outer segment (OS) PM
  • cell & other
    REGULATION
    activated by cyclic GMP which leads to an opening of the cation channel and thereby causing a depolarization of rod photoreceptors
    Other closed in the light
